During spermatogenesis, the ________ are haploid cells that require further differentiation in order to become functional spermatozoa.

Final answer:

The haploid cells in spermatogenesis that develop into functional spermatozoa are called spermatids, which undergo spermiogenesis to become mature sperm.

Step-by-step explanation:

During spermatogenesis, the haploid cells that require further differentiation in order to become functional spermatozoa are called spermatids. After the process of mitosis and the two rounds of meiosis, the primary spermatocytes divide to form secondary spermatocytes, which then undergo meiosis II to produce spermatids. These spermatids are initially round with a central nucleus and a significant amount of cytoplasm.

Then a transformation process known as spermiogenesis occurs, where the early spermatids undergo morphological changes, reducing the cytoplasm and shaping themselves into mature sperm with a flagellum, a compact head, and a middle piece rich in mitochondria. This detailed structuring is vital for the functionality of the sperm as it allows for motility and the efficient delivery of genetic material to the ovum.
